Simple Strategies to Improve Indoor Air Quality

Before diving into advanced technologies, let’s explore simple and practical strategies that can positively impact indoor air quality in your home or commercial space:

1. Regular Cleaning: Consistently cleaning your living or working environment can significantly reduce dust, allergens, and other pollutants. Vacuum carpets and upholstery regularly, dust surfaces, and mop floors to remove debris and contaminants.

2. Proper Ventilation: Ensure that your space is well-ventilated to allow for adequate air circulation and reduce the concentration of indoor pollutants. Open windows when appropriate and utilize exhaust fans in high-humidity areas, such as kitchens and bathrooms.

3. Controlling Humidity: Maintain optimal indoor humidity levels (between 30% and 50%) to prevent the growth of mould and mildew. A dehumidifier or HVAC system with humidity controls can assist in managing humidity levels.

4. Air Purifying Plants: Incorporate indoor plants, such as the spider plant and snake plant, which naturally purify the air by absorbing common pollutants like formaldehyde and benzene.

HVAC Solutions for Improved Indoor Air Quality

HVAC systems can play a pivotal role in enhancing indoor air quality. Consider these HVAC solutions and technologies to foster a healthier environment in your home or commercial space:

1. Regular HVAC Maintenance: Schedule routine maintenance of your heating and cooling systems to ensure optimal performance and efficiency. This includes cleaning or changing air filters, which can become clogged with dirt and debris, reducing air quality.

2. Air Filtration and Purification Systems: Implementing advanced air filtration and purification systems can significantly reduce pollutants and allergens in your indoor environment. High-Efficiency Particulate Air (HEPA) filters can trap 99.97% of particles as small as 0.3 microns, making them an excellent choice for those suffering from allergies or asthma.

3. UV Germicidal Lamps: Installing ultraviolet (UV) germicidal lamps in your HVAC system can help neutralize bacteria, viruses, and mould spores, promoting a cleaner and healthier indoor environment.

4. Heat Recovery Ventilators (HRVs): HRVs exchange stale indoor air with fresh outdoor air, preserving heat energy during winter and providing balanced ventilation. This can lead to enhanced comfort, reduced energy costs, and improved indoor air quality.

Selecting the Right Air Filtration System for Your Needs

When choosing an air filtration system for your home or commercial space, consider the following factors to ensure optimal performance and desired results:

1. Filter Ratings: The Minimum Efficiency Reporting Value (MERV) rating indicates the efficiency of an air filter in capturing particles of varying sizes. Higher MERV ratings signify greater filtration capabilities. For most residential applications, MERV ratings between 8 and 13 are sufficient.

2. Specific Needs: Consider any unique needs or health concerns of the occupants, such as allergies, asthma, or sensitivities to chemical pollutants. HEPA filters or activated carbon filters are particularly beneficial for individuals with allergies or chemical sensitivities.

3. System Compatibility: Ensure that the chosen air filtration system is compatible with your existing HVAC system. Consult with a professional HVAC technician to confirm compatibility and installation requirements.

4. Maintenance Requirements: Factor in the maintenance needs of the air filtration system, such as filter replacement frequency and costs.

Assessing Energy Efficiency

Energy efficiency should be a top priority when selecting an HVAC system for your home, as it directly impacts utility bills, environmental footprint, and long-term savings. To gauge a system’s energy efficiency, consider the following specifications:

1. Seasonal Energy Efficiency Ratio (SEER): This metric indicates the cooling efficiency of an air conditioner or heat pump during the cooling season. The higher the SEER rating, the more energy-efficient the system is.

2. Heating Seasonal Performance Factor (HSPF): For heat pumps, the HSPF rating measures heating efficiency during the heating season. Similar to SEER ratings, a higher HSPF means improved energy efficiency.

3. Annual Fuel Utilization Efficiency (AFUE): This measurement is used for furnaces and boilers, indicating the percentage of fuel converted to heat over a year. A higher AFUE percentage translates to greater fuel efficiency.

Investing in a high-efficiency HVAC system can lead to lower energy bills and a reduced environmental impact, making it a wise choice for eco-conscious consumers.

Choosing the Correct System Size

Selecting the appropriate size for your HVAC system is vital for its performance, comfort, and energy efficiency. A system that is too small may struggle to maintain the desired temperature, causing uncomfortable fluctuations and increased energy consumption. Conversely, an oversized system may cycle on and off too frequently, leading to inefficient heating or cooling and shortened system lifespan. To determine the right size for your home, consider these factors:

1. Square Footage: Calculate the total area of your home to be heated or cooled, as this is the primary basis for determining the HVAC system size.

2. Climate: The local climate plays a significant role in choosing the ideal HVAC system, as extreme temperatures demand more substantial heating or cooling capacities. Homes in colder climates may require a larger furnace, while those in hot regions might benefit from a more powerful air conditioning unit.

3. Insulation and Air Leakage: Assessing your home’s insulation levels and sealing any air leaks is essential for optimizing HVAC system performance. An adequately insulated and air-sealed home allows for more accurate sizing and increased energy efficiency.

4. Professional Sizing: Consulting an experienced HVAC professional can provide expert guidance in determining the right system size for your home. They may perform a Manual J Load Calculation, a widely recognized method for accurately sizing an HVAC system based on factors like insulation, wall and window types, and climate.

Understanding Different HVAC System Types

There is a diverse range of HVAC systems available in the market, each with its distinct features and benefits. Understanding the different types can help you choose the best-suited option for your home:

1. Central Air Conditioners and Furnaces: These combined systems use a network of ducts to distribute cool and warm air throughout your home, providing even temperature control. They offer high efficiency and extensive coverage, making them suitable for larger homes.

2. Heat Pumps: Heat pumps can both heat and cool your home, making them a versatile option. They extract heat from the outdoor air during winter and transfer it indoors, while in summer, they operate in reverse to cool your home. They are energy-efficient and can be paired with gas furnaces for optimum performance in colder climates.

3. Ductless Mini-Split Systems: These systems do not require ductwork, making them ideal for homes without existing duct infrastructure or for targeted room-by-room climate control. They are highly efficient and offer flexible installation options.

4. Geothermal Heat Pumps: These systems source heat from the ground to provide heating and cooling, offering exceptional energy efficiency and reduced environmental impact. Though they come with higher upfront costs, geothermal heat pumps can yield significant long-term savings and are ideal for eco-conscious homeowners.

The Importance of Regular HVAC Maintenance for Residential and Commercial Spaces

1. Enhancing System Efficiency and Energy Savings

One of the primary advantages of regular HVAC maintenance is increased energy efficiency. Over time, dust, dirt, and debris can accumulate in various components of the system, obstructing airflow and reducing efficiency. For instance, a clogged air filter can force your system to work harder to circulate air, resulting in higher energy consumption. Regular inspection and cleaning of such elements can lead to improved performance and energy savings.

Scheduled maintenance also allows for optimization of system settings, fine-tuning temperature controls, and ensuring correct refrigerant levels. These adjustments contribute to enhanced efficiency and can lower energy costs for residential and commercial spaces.

2. Prolonging System Lifespan and Reducing Repair Costs

A well-maintained HVAC system is less prone to breakdowns and costly repairs in the long run. Regular maintenance helps detect and address potential issues before they escalate or cause further damage to other components. For example, fixing a loose part or sealing a refrigerant leak can prevent premature wear or failure of the compressor, saving you significant repair or replacement costs.

Furthermore, investing in routine HVAC maintenance can lead to an extended system lifespan. Consistent cleaning, lubrication, and inspection of parts contribute to the smooth operation of the system and reduce stress on components, preventing premature failures and allowing you to get the most out of your investment.

3. Maintaining Indoor Comfort and Air Quality

A well-functioning HVAC system is crucial for maintaining consistent indoor comfort levels and ensuring a healthy living or working environment. Regular maintenance can help uphold desired temperature settings, prevent cold or hot spots, and ensure proper humidity levels for both residential and commercial spaces.

Moreover, consistent HVAC maintenance also contributes to improved indoor air quality by reducing dust, allergens, and pollutants that can accumulate within the system. Cleaning air filter replacements, duct cleaning, and examination of the air handler are essential steps in maintaining a clean airflow throughout your home or business.

Practical Guidelines for Scheduled HVAC Maintenance

To reap the benefits of regular HVAC maintenance, consider the following best practices:

1. Professional Annual Inspections: Schedule an annual inspection and maintenance appointment with an experienced HVAC professional who can thoroughly clean, inspect, and service your system. For heating equipment, plan this before the winter season, while for cooling systems, consider scheduling maintenance in the spring to prepare for the summer months.

2. Filter Maintenance: Check your system’s air filters at least once every 1-3 months and replace or clean them as needed. This simple task can significantly impact your system’s efficiency, air quality, and longevity.

3. Seasonal Checkups: Perform seasonal checkups to ensure smooth transitions between heating and cooling modes. Verify proper thermostat settings, clean outdoor units, and check for any signs of wear or damage that may require professional attention.

4. Keep the Area Around Your System Clear: Ensure that the area around your indoor and outdoor HVAC components is free from debris, clutter, or vegetation. This will allow for accessible airflow and reduce the risk of damage or obstructions to your equipment.

The Health Impacts of Poor Indoor Air Quality

Poor indoor air quality can lead to various health issues, ranging from short-term irritations to chronic conditions. These health problems can be caused by different pollutants and contaminants, such as allergens, chemicals, and microbes. Some common health consequences of poor indoor air quality include:

1. Respiratory Issues: Breathing in polluted indoor air can cause irritation and inflammation of the respiratory system, leading to symptoms such as coughing, wheezing, and shortness of breath. Long-term exposure to poor air quality can also contribute to the development of respiratory diseases, such as asthma and chronic obstructive pulmonary disease (COPD).

2. Allergies and Sinus Problems: Allergens like dust mites, pollen, and pet dander are prevalent in indoor environments. Their presence can trigger allergic reactions, resulting in symptoms like sneezing, runny nose, itchy eyes, and sinus congestion.

3. Headaches and Fatigue: Indoor air pollution can cause headaches and fatigue by affecting the brain’s oxygen supply. Poor circulation and ventilation in confined spaces can worsen these symptoms.

4. Skin Irritation: Chemicals present in indoor air, such as formaldehyde and volatile organic compounds (VOCs), can cause skin irritation and inflammation, leading to rashes and eczema.

Ventilation for Improved Indoor Air Quality

Proper ventilation plays a crucial role in maintaining healthy indoor air quality by replacing stale and contaminated air with fresh outdoor air. Some essential ventilation strategies for improving indoor air quality:

1. Natural Ventilation: Opening windows and doors allows fresh air to flow into your home, diluting the concentration of indoor air pollutants and ensuring continuous air exchange. However, this method may not be sufficient in areas with high outdoor pollution or frigid climates.

2. Mechanical Ventilation: HVAC systems equipped with efficient fans and ductwork can facilitate air exchange by drawing fresh air from the outdoors, filtering it, and distributing it throughout the building. Mechanical ventilation systems can also help remove moisture and foul odours from the indoor environment.

3. Balanced Ventilation: Energy recovery ventilators (ERVs) and heat recovery ventilators (HRVs) are advanced ventilation systems designed to provide a consistent fresh air supply while minimizing energy loss. These systems precondition incoming outdoor air by either transferring heat or exchanging both heat and moisture with the exhaust air from the building.

Air Filtration and Cleaning Solutions

Effective air filtration and purification systems can contribute significantly towards improving indoor air quality by removing allergens, bacteria, viruses, and other pollutants. HVAC systems can incorporate various filtration and cleaning technologies, including:

1. High-Efficiency Particulate Air (HEPA) Filters: These filters can trap up to 99.97% of particles as small as 0.3 microns in size, making them one of the most efficient air filtration solutions available. Regularly changing or cleaning your air filter can ensure optimal performance and maintain healthy indoor air quality.

2. Electronic Air Cleaners: These devices work by generating an electric field that attracts and captures airborne particles, effectively removing them from the air. Some electronic air cleaners also produce a small amount of ozone to neutralize odours and kill microbes.

3. Ultraviolet (UV) Germicidal Lights: UV lights can effectively neutralize bacteria, viruses, and mould spores by disrupting their DNA. These systems can be integrated into your HVAC system, helping sterilize the air that passes through while preventing microbial growth on your air conditioning coils and ducts.

Maintaining Ideal Humidity Levels

Maintaining an ideal humidity level is crucial for preserving healthy indoor air quality. Excessive moisture in your home can encourage mould growth and the proliferation of dust mites, while extremely dry conditions can exacerbate respiratory issues and skin problems. HVAC systems play an essential role in regulating indoor humidity levels through:

1. Dehumidifiers: These devices can remove excess moisture from the air to prevent mould growth and improve indoor comfort levels.

2. Humidifiers: In drier climates or during winter months, humidifiers can add moisture to the air to alleviate dry skin, irritated nasal passages, and respiratory discomfort.
